💨 Abstract
Kohl's, an American department store chain, is closing 27 underperforming stores across 15 states by April 2025, affecting locations in California, Illinois, Ohio, Virginia, and others. The company is also shutting down an e-commerce distribution center in California. Kohl's CEO Tom Kingsbury made these decisions as part of a long-term growth strategy, offering affected employees opportunities within the company or severance packages.
